Python学习笔记str_to_list字符串转列表 记录几种字符串转列表方法,方便自己查阅。 使用以下字符串完成后续转换 1、list()函数,无要求转换,此种方式会以字符串中单个元素为分隔转为列表(每一个特殊字符、空格、字母、数字都会单独成为列表的一个元素) + View Code 运行结果: 2、split()函数,指定转换,此种方式可...
#(1)check one y2= np.array(ya)# ['C','A'] #this is what i not want y2_test = y2.shape# 0-d y2_test2 = y2.tolist()# dtype shows not list #the right methon #(2)check one ls = ya.strip('][').split(',') # dtype show list #(3) right methon import ast ls =...
在Python中时常需要从字符串类型str中提取元素到一个数组list中,例如str是一个逗号隔开的姓名名单,需要将每个名字提取到一个元素为str型的list中。 如姓名列表str = 'Alice, Bob, John',需要将其提取为name_list = ['Alice', 'Bob', 'John']。 而反过来有时需要将一个list中的字符元素按照指定的分隔符拼接...
与list.append(x) 类似, list.insert(i,x) 也是对list元素的增加。只不过是可以在任何位置增加一个元素。 最好不要用 list 作为变量名字,因为它是Python 中内置的对象类型的名字 la = ['qiwsir', 'github', 'io'] # list.insert(i, x) i 是将元素 x 插入到列表中的位置 从0 开始 la.insert(0,"...
str to list: >>>str="123456">>>list(str)['1','2','3','4','5','6']>>>str2="123 abc hello">>>str2.split()#按空格分割成字符串['123','abc','hello'] 或者 >>>str2.split(" ")['123','abc','hello'] list to str: ...
1、一般str转list 2、str有空格或者逗号 3、看上去是list的str转list 1、一般str转list 列表内遍历 s = "hello" list_from_str = [char for char in s] print(list_from_str) # 输出: ['h', 'e', 'l', 'l', 'o'] 使用list函数 s = "hello" list_from_str = list(s) print(list_from...
class StringToList StringToList : +str_to_list(s: str) : list 在类图中,定义了一个名为StringToList的类,其中包含了一个方法str_to_list()用于将字符串转换为列表。 结语 通过本文的介绍,相信读者已经了解了如何将字符串整体转换为列表的一个字段,并掌握了相应的代码实现方法。在实际应用中,根据具体需求...
在python中时常需要从字符串类型str中提取元素到一个数组list中,例如str是一个逗号隔开的姓名名单,需要将每个名字提取到一个元素为str型的list中。 如姓名列表str = 'Alice, Bob, John',需要将其提取为name_list = ['Alice', 'Bob', 'John']。
str to list eval()将一个字符串形式的列表转换成列表 例: list() 无要求转换,此种方式会以字符串中单个元素为分隔转为列表(每一个特殊字符、空格、字母、...
在Python中,如果遇到一种情况,即需要将STR格式的列表转换成标准的list格式,可以使用eval函数来实现。下面是一个简单的示例:假设有如下字符串:s = '[[1,2],[3,4],5,6]'通过eval函数,可以直接将这个字符串转换成对应的list对象:s = eval('[[1,2],[3,4],5,6]')运行结果如下:>>>...